August weather forecast
Dulce Nombre de María, El Salvador

August

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Dulce Nombre de María, is another hot month, with an average temperature ranging between min 20.8°C (69.4°F) and max 31.8°C (89.2°F).

Temperature

August notes an average high-temperature of a still hot 31.8°C (89.2°F), subtly differing from July's 32°C (89.6°F). Dulce Nombre de María records an average low-temperature of 20.8°C (69.4°F) throughout the month of August.

Heat index

During August, the heat index is estimated at a blisteringly hot 43°C (109.4°F). Prudent: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are likely. Heatstroke becomes imminent with sustained exertion.
Know that the heat index computations account for shaded terrains and slight winds. Direct exposure to sunlight could ra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'felt air temperature', is a single figure representing how weather conditions feel when combining temperature and humidity. Additional elements including metabolic differences, the level of physical activity, and attire have a role in shaping the individual's temperature perception. One's exposure to direct sunlight has the potential to intensify the heat sensation, increasing the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old great significance to children. Youngsters often neglect the necessity for rest and hydration. Thirst is a sign of advancing dehydration - thus the importance of maintaining hydration, specifically during long-lasting physical activities.
In response to overheating, the human body perspires to cool down, mainly through the evaporation of sweat. A surge in relative humidity can disrupt the body's normal cooling function by slowing evaporation, hence reducing the rate at which the body cools and intensifying the perception of heat. Heat-related challenges, like dehydration, can be anticipated when body heat isn't managed effectively.

Humidity

In August, the average relative humidity in Dulce Nombre de María is 79%.

Rainfall

In Dulce Nombre de María, in August, during 26.6 rainfall days, 144mm (5.67") of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Dulce Nombre de María, there are 192.2 rainfall days, and 1062mm (41.81")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August in Dulce Nombre de María is 12h and 35min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:40 and sunset at 18:24. On the last day of August, in Dulce Nombre de María, sunrise is at 05:44 and sunset at 18:08 CST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August is 10.6h.

UV index

January, June through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The UV index of 6 during August translates into the following guidance:
Sustain precautions and conform to sun safety norms. Preventing sunburn is necessary. Limit your direct sun exposure, especially between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is strongest. Shade structures might not provide complete sun protection. Loose clothes with a tight weave are optimal for safeguarding yourself against the Sun's rays.
